Milford, De vs Puerto Princesa, Palawan Climate & Distance Between

Philippines flag
  • The distance between Milford, De, Usa and Puerto Princesa, Palawan, Philippines is approximately 14,411 km or 8,955 mi.
  • To reach Milford, De in this distance one would set out from Puerto Princesa, Palawan bearing 13.9°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Milford, De bearing 162.3° or SSE .
  • Milford, De has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Puerto Princesa, Palawan has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Milford, De is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Puerto Princesa, Palawan is in or near the trop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 14.2 °C (25.6°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 21.9 °C (39.4°F) more in Milford, De.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 502.8 mm (19.8 in) less which is equivalent to 502.8 l/m² (12.34 US gal/ft²) or 5,028,000 l/ha (537,527 US gal/ac) less. About 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 22.6° lower in Milford, De than in Puerto Princesa, Palawan.
